Annie Jones (born Annika Jancso 13 January 1967 in Adelaide) is an Australian actress, known in Australia and overseas for her role as Jane Harris in the soap opera Neighbours. She has won two Logie Awards.

Her parents were Hungarian immigrants who met when in Adelaide, and married after her father found employment as an opal miner. She has three older sisters. The family spent many years in Coober Pedy.

Working under the name Annie Jones, she undertook some modelling, and began acting aged 17 in the role of Chrissie in the film drama Run Chrissie Run!. She then appeared in television roles The Henderson Kids (1985), and Sons and Daughters (1986) as Jesse Campbell.

Having auditioned for the role of Charlene Mitchell (which she lost to Kylie Minogue), at age 19, she landed the role of Jane Harris in Neighbours (1986–89), which brought her a high public profile. This culminated in her receiving the Logie Award for Most Popular Actress in 1989. She was also an opalminer's daughter in "The Flying Doctors" in 1990. Jones played the title role in the drama Jackaroo (1990), which won her a second Logie award in 1991 – Most Popular Actress in a Telemovie or Mini-series. She also starred as Eva Kovac in the historical mini-series Snowy (1993).

In comedy, she co-starred in the Australian sitcom Newlyweds (1993–94) and guest starred in The Adventures of Lano & Woodley (1997). In children's TV, she played the mother in Pig's Breakfast (1999) and appeared in the Mortified episode Mother in the Nude (2006). Jones has also guest starred in many Australian series including Wentworth (2013), City Homicide (2007), Stingers (2003), Blue Heelers (1994, 2002), Marshall Law (2002), Good Guys, Bad Guys (1997) and Halifax f.p. (2006).
